New Mexico is the only state that allows you to form an LLC without disclosing the members names to the government, making it the option that offers the most privacy.

Florida allows anonymous LLCs via what is commonly called a Double LLC. In Florida you must list the member, so the key is to form an anonymous company in Wyoming and list it as the member.
Alternatively, if you live in a state that does not allow the filing for an anonymous LLC, you can use a double LLC/Holding company setup. For instance, if an owner must be listed, then make the owner an anonymous company from another state. New York does not allow the withholding of owner information.
When you form a Florida LLC, you must list the members or managers who are responsible for managing the company on your Articles of Organization. You are required to include their names, their addresses, and their titles (either Member or Manager).
If you want to form an LLC that is anonymous in Florida, your first step will actually be to form one in a different state. That is because Florida does not allow anonymous limited liability companies in an obvious manner and this will let you get around it.
How to Name Your Florida LLC Your LLC Name Must Be Unique. The business name you select cannot be in use by any other corporation or LLC in the state. Your LLC Name Must Not Be Confusable with Another Business Name. Your LLC Name Must Contain Certain Words. Your LLC Name May Be Subject to Other General Restrictions.
An anonymous limited liability company (LLC) is one that hides all ownership information. This can be done by creating an anonymous LLC in a state that allows it and then using a different person to register it. The secrecy jurisdiction keeps company information anonymous.
